Why Football World Rankings Teams Matter
The football world rankings teams matter because they influence tournament seedings, qualification paths, and even the perception of national football programs. A higher ranking can give a team favorable draws in competitions, while a drop can make their road to success more difficult.
Fans remember how Belgium’s long reign at No. 1 shaped narratives, or how Argentina’s surge after winning the World Cup cemented their status as global giants. Rankings are not just statistics—they’re reflections of football’s evolving story.
Current Top Football World Rankings Teams
As of early 2026, the football world rankings teams are led by Spain, who hold the No. 1 spot thanks to consistent performances in qualifiers and tournaments. Argentina follows closely, still riding the momentum of their World Cup triumph. France, England, and Brazil round out the top five, showcasing the balance between European and South American powerhouses.
On the women’s side, Spain also leads, with the USA and Germany trailing behind. This dual dominance highlights Spain’s golden era across both men’s and women’s football.
Memorable Shifts in Rankings
The football world rankings teams have seen dramatic shifts over the years. Germany’s fall after their 2018 World Cup exit, Belgium’s rise to the top despite not winning a major trophy, and Morocco’s surge following their historic 2022 World Cup semifinal run all show how rankings capture the highs and lows of football nations.
These shifts remind fans that rankings are dynamic, reflecting not just talent but consistency and resilience.
